On the nature of federal bankruptcy jurisdiction: A general statutory and constitutional theory.

Research output: Contribution to journalArticlepeer-review

Abstract

Formulates a determinate constitutional theory of federal bankruptcy jurisdiction in the United States. Scope of the federal bankruptcy jurisdiction; Source and limits of federal judicial power; Application of the federal question jurisprudence on the role of a federal bankruptcy trustee.
